Dr Carla Pascoe Leahy is a Lecturer in Family History at the University of Tasmania. Carla is an expert in Australian motherhood and childhood in the present and the recent past. She recently completed the first major project tracking the overarching history of Australian motherhood, interviewing over 60 diverse women about their experience of becoming a mother, and is now available in her new book.
